5 Easy Steps To Successful Offline Promotion
by Kerry Wallis, Ker

The following step by step guide is completely foolproof, and one I have utilised successfully in the UK Franchise sector for many years.

This marketing strategy works for both online and offline business with amazing results. You will NOT be disappointed!

To achieve these amazing results there are key rules which must be strictly applied with no "tweaking" at all, the detail is extremely important to maximise the effect.... All promotional activity must be completed within a 10 Day timescale, so planning is key!

STEP 1: 1 Quality branded advertisement in a local newspaper. Look for days of peak readership for maximising results also ask your paper about late space for a really cost effective promotion, have your artwork on disc or a download to speed placement up.

STEP 2: 50 Word of Mouth, these must be to complete strangers, including your name and full contact information for your business, preferably accompanied by a business card. (Just talking about your business all the time is not the same as quality word of mouth.) Good places are the checkout queue, school gates to name but a few...

STEP 3: 2000 leaflets/flyers delivered to households. (if your business has a fixed address you would radiate out from this central point to the nearest 2000 homes) Always ensure you cover a concentrated area leaving no gaps, I advise street map planning for this. Also key to this element is the delivery day should only be a Sunday or public holiday when there are no regular postal deliveries, this minimises the postal sift into the bin!. Highly reccommend as many helpers as possible, 2000 leaflets equates to approx 15 hours, so 5 people means only 3 hours each etc..
with delivery do not be tempted to pay a paid delivery service or insert in a newspaper, these alternate routes are just not effective. also you could utilise this time to do word of mouth at the same time, double whammy!!

STEP 4: 50 posters covering the same geographic area (STEP 4). Points to remember professional branding/design but I recommend handwritten clear text- adds a human/personal touch. Place in newsagents, hairdressers, cafes, gyms etc...Always at eye level, with easy to read text.

STEP 5: Probably the most difficult to master, but fantastically successful..

EDITORIAL, basically a story about, you and your business or a customer of yours, printed in a local paper. Look for quirky angles, get to know your paper, Never Ever Pay that would be Advertorial and nowhere near as effective.
I will write more about Editorial in future articles.

To conclude completing all elements exactly within the 10 day timesscale compounds the effect.. to explain, on sunday I receive a leaflet, on Monday I see a poster at the supermarket, then on Thursday I read your advertisement in this paper, its the layering effect that makes this so effective, one element alone may not be enough to gain new business.
